aladowinged

Alado means "winged". It's a beautifully poetic and uncommon adjective used in the song to describe a "hombre alado" — a winged man.

This powerful image casts the narrator as a modern-day Icarus, flying over the intense city of "fury". The song uses this metaphor to explore feelings of escape and vulnerability, especially in the iconic line "Con la luz del sol se derriten mis alas" (With the sunlight, my wings melt).

This song from Argentine legends Soda Stereo drops you into a strange and beautiful dream. The singer describes himself as a winged man, flying over the “ciudad de la furia” [city of fury], which we learn is Buenos Aires. He feels both anonymous and connected, saying “donde nadie sabe de mí / Y yo soy parte de todos” [where nobody knows me / and I am part of everyone]. It’s a lonely perspective, looking down on a city where he sees “el temor” [the fear] in people's faces.

But this winged man is not just a passive observer. He is also a creature of the night, a bit like a modern-day Icarus who says “Con la luz del sol / Se derriten mis alas” [With the sunlight / my wings melt]. His world is the darkness, where he finds a secret lover. He asks her to hide him and let him “dormir al amanecer / Entre tus piernas” [sleep at dawn / between your legs]. It's a very direct, intimate image of finding refuge from the world. The song paints this amazing contrast between soaring over a tense city and finding a safe, secret place in another person's arms before the sun comes up.
